The eye care plan, from Vision Service Plan (VSP), gives you access to a vast, nationwide network of ophthalmologists and optometrists.  When visiting a VSP network physician you will receive an eye exam and lenses once every twelve months and frames provided once every twenty-four months after a minimal co-pay.

Without VSP, you can expect to pay an average of $115 for an eye exam, $223 for single vision glasses, and $249 for bifocal glasses. With VSP, your eye exam is fully covered after a $15 co-pay and your prescription glasses are fully covered up to your allowances after a $25 co-pay.  To locate a VSP doctor in your area, call 1.800.877.7195 or click here to visit them online.
